South Cockerington - Wikipedia

WebIt is situated approximately 4 miles (6 km) east from the market town of Louth . The parish church is a Grade I listed building dedicated to Saint Leonard dating from the early 14th century, and restored in 1872–73. It is built from greenstone, limestone and brick. WebDalby is a village and civil parish in the East Lindsey district of Lincolnshire, England.It is situated approximately 3 miles (5 km) north from the town of Spilsby.It is in the civil parish of Sausthorpe.. Dalby church is dedicated to Saint Lawrence and Bishop Edward King, and is a Grade II listed building built in 1862 by James Fowler of Louth to replace an earlier church.

WebMareham le Fen (otherwise Mareham-le-Fen) is a village and civil parish about 6 miles (10 km) south from the town of Horncastle, Lincolnshire, England. The hamlet of Mareham Gate lies about 0.5 miles (0.8 km) south from the village, and it is believed that the deserted medieval village (DMV) of Birkwood is situated nearby. WebPolice are urging people to avoid the A16 if possible, as the road will be closed until 6.30pm at least. Three vehicles were involved in the crash - a Vauxhall Corsa, a Volkswagon coupé and a Chrysler MPV. The driver and the passenger in the Corsa suffered serious injuries and were taken to Grimsby Hospital.
